yay error: gpg: keyserver receive failed: No name

I am trying to install spotify using yay on Arch linux. But when I run yay -S spotify this happens:

:: PGP keys need importing:
 -> --some-key--, required by: spotify
==> Import? [Y/n] y
:: Importing keys with gpg...
gpg: keyserver receive failed: No name
problem importing keys

How can I fix this error to install package successfully ?

It was solved by manually adding gpg key by this command:

gpg --keyserver keyserver.ubuntu.com --recv-key <key name>

and running installation again:

yay -S spotify
